If any global changes will be made to Lucario, it should be something like this:Also, lowering the cap of Aura % is nothing more than scaling. In Brawl+, not one lives to 172 anymore. You normally die on average at 100-140. That's because of increased hitstun, reduced hitlag (harder to DI), and no stale moves (KB is always 100%/Rack up %s quicker.)
Because of that, leaving the cap at 172 means that Lucario will never reach full power because he'll be long KO'd before 150%.
172 is a percent which you could normally get to in Normal Brawl, but not IN Brawl+, so because of that, lowering the cap to a percent he normally dies at with normal/bad DI, scales his abilities to a point where its actually worth something. Ya feel me? If the cap was lowered to 140% which is a ridiculously high percent to live to in Brawl+ (****, 130% is high), he'd be able to reach full power within the normal life span in Brawl+.
